Researchers at the University of Toronto have unveiled "Temporal Graph--LLM Synchronization" (TGLS), a novel algorithmic framework that enables Large Language Models (LLMs) to maintain real--time consistency with dynamically updating knowledge graphs. Announced on September 1, 2026, the system utilizes "Delta--Encoding" to propagate structural changes from live data streams into the LLM's reasoning context with an 80% reduction in computational overhead. For the business sector, this breakthrough facilitates "High--Frequency Decision Intelligence," allowing financial services and supply chain operators to execute AI--driven analysis on volatile data environments without the risk of stale information or structural hallucinations.
